is not suppressed by pretreatment with the p38 inhibitor
LTC4s increases following spared nerve injury, significant increase 3 days after nerve injury and continues at least for 14 days. LTC4s mRNA is expressed constitutively throughout the grey matter and increases after nerve injury in dorsal horn. This increase in LTC4s mRNA mainly occurrs in cells with small nuclei
hepatic mRNA expression of LTC4S is decreased in presence of NO donor O2-vinyl-1-(pyrrolidin-1-yl)-diazen-1-ium-1,2-diolate, i.e. V-PYRRO/NO. Downregulation may occur via inhibiting NF-kappaB activation independent of IkappaBalpha during hepatic ischemia/reperfusion injury
